Drinking Water Facts

  1. The water in your toilet entered your house through the same pipe as the water in your kitchen sink.
  2. Americans spend $10,980,000,000 annually on bottled water. (link)
  3. The Safe Drinking Water Act (SDWA) is a United States federal law passed by the U.S. Congress on December 16, 1974. It is the main federal law that ensures safe drinking water for Americans. (link)
  4. Less than 1% of the earth’s water is fresh water, and only about one-third of this 1% is available for human use.
  5. Over 1 billion people today do not have access to safe water. (link)
  6. Every 8 seconds a child dies of a waterborne disease (5 million children a year). (link, link)
  7. “More people die each year from unsafe water than from all forms of violence, including war.” One person in six lives without regular access to safe drinking water (UN Sec. Gen. Kofi Annan). (link)
  8. There are existing technologies that can provide safe drinking water to health care facilities, orphanages and villages for less than $1000 US


The bottom line is that we in America have cleaner water in our toilets than most developing nations have to drink. Unfortunately, global warming is vogue' a global water shortage is not. We, as a nation, indulge in 25 billion litters of bottled water a year while people are left to survive drinking water laced with filth.

Two thirds of Chinese cities' water, air polluted


BEIJING (Reuters) - Nearly two-thirds of Chinese cities suffered from air pollution last year and had no centralized sewage treatment facilities, state media reported on Tuesday.

Only 37.6 percent of 585 cities surveyed had air quality "indicating a clean and healthy environment," down 7.3 percentage points from 2005, the China Daily said, citing a report by the State Environmental Protection Agency (SEPA). (link)
